Shane Ross: That is where the remuneration is charged to in the accounts. Does Ms Kerins understand that this is disappointing? We have asked representatives of Rehab here today because of what is obviously perceived as a massive lack of transparency. She is as aware as anybody else of the problems in the charity industry. I do not dispute the great work done by the group; nobody would do so as it is...

Shane Ross: That statement is somewhat difficult to take. We are entitled to ask to attend the people who we think will be useful to us. For Ms Kerins to come back and say Rehab has decided the other people will or somebody else will attend is absurd. It is clear that we wanted to ask questions on this whole issue of remuneration, and on which this whole meeting has concentrated more than any others....
